The Importance of Blood Tests for Monitoring Thyroid Health

The Importance of Blood Tests for Monitoring Thyroid Health

The Importance of Blood Tests for Monitoring Thyroid Health

Blood tests are vital for monitoring thyroid health by measuring thyroid hormone levels (TSH, T3, T4). They help detect thyroid disorders like hypothyroidism and hyperthyroidism, enabling timely and effective treatment.

Blood tests play a crucial role in monitoring thyroid health and detecting thyroid disorders. Here’s why they are essential and what you need to know:

  • Key Thyroid Hormones:
    • Thyroid Stimulating Hormone (TSH): Produced by the pituitary gland, TSH regulates thyroid hormone production. High levels indicate hypothyroidism (underactive thyroid), and low levels suggest hyperthyroidism (overactive thyroid).
    • Free Thyroxine (Free T4): This hormone is directly produced by the thyroid gland. It helps assess thyroid function alongside TSH.
    • Triiodothyronine (T3): T3 is another thyroid hormone crucial for metabolism. Free T3 tests can help diagnose hyperthyroidism when TSH is low.
  • Why Blood Tests Matter:
    • Detecting Disorders:
      • Hypothyroidism: Symptoms include fatigue, weight gain, and depression. Low Free T4 and high TSH levels typically diagnose this condition.
      • Hyperthyroidism: Symptoms include weight loss, palpitations, and anxiety. High Free T4 and low TSH levels are indicative.
    • Comprehensive Screening:
      • Thyroid Panel: A complete thyroid panel includes TSH, Free T4, and Free T3 tests, providing a comprehensive overview of thyroid health.
      • Thyroid Antibodies: Tests for thyroid peroxidase antibodies (TPO) and thyroglobulin antibodies can diagnose autoimmune thyroid diseases like Hashimoto’s thyroiditis and Graves’ disease.
  • Routine Monitoring:
    • Medication Adjustment: Regular blood tests help tailor medication doses for thyroid disorders, ensuring effective management and minimizing side effects.
    • Long-term Health: Consistent monitoring aids in managing long-term health complications associated with thyroid disorders, such as cardiovascular risks and metabolic issues.
  • Interpreting Results:
    • TSH Levels:
      • High TSH: Indicates an underactive thyroid (hypothyroidism).
      • Low TSH: Suggests an overactive thyroid (hyperthyroidism).
    • Free T4 Levels:
      • Low Free T4: Suggests hypothyroidism.
      • High Free T4: Indicates hyperthyroidism.
    • Free T3 Levels:
      • High Free T3: Associated with hyperthyroidism.
  • Recommended Practices:
    • Regular Testing: Individuals, especially those with symptoms or a family history of thyroid disorders, should undergo regular thyroid function tests.
    • Comprehensive Approach: Blood tests should be part of a holistic approach including physical exams and patient history.
